The contract requires the management of international freight forwarding and customs clearance for the export of goods from Secaucus, New Jersey, to Ankara, Turkey, under project code 795 TP 2. This includes end-to-end logistics coordination, accurate documentation preparation, and compliance with both U.S. and Turkish regulatory requirements, with a specific focus on tracking the shipment through the designated project code. The service scope encompasses all transportation arrangements, customs brokerage, and documentation necessary to facilitate smooth import and export processes across international borders. Issued as a subcontract under the NAICS code 488510 for other support activities related to air, water, and other transportation, the contract is sponsored by the Electrical Devices Division within the Department of Defense. The solicitation was posted on July 22, 2026, with responses due by August 3, 2026. While no specific point of contact or detailed place of performance beyond the origin and destination is provided, the work must align with the U.S. Department of Defense’s requirements for secure and timely delivery. All parties must adhere to federal contracting standards and ensure full traceability of the shipment throughout its journey.
